What is an Expert Advisor ?
A Forex Expert Advisor (a.k.a. Forex Trading Robot, EA,
MT-4 EA, Automated Forex Trading Software) is a mechanical trading system
written in the MQL-4 programming language and designed to automate trading
activities on the MetaTrader 4 platform. Expert Advisors can be programmed to
alert you of a trading opportunity and can also trade your account automatically
managing all aspects of trading operations from sending orders directly to your
broker’s server to automatically adjusting stop loss, trailing stops and take
profit levels.
Expert Advisors for MetaTrader 4 are all unique and different in the rules
they follow to enter and exit the market. Expert Advisors eliminate emotional
trading decisions that cripple novice trading accounts. Forex Expert Advisors
allow investors to exercise a very strict trading system without falling outside
pre-programmed parameters and it is this rock solid consistency one of the
features that make these programs so attractive to serious investors. Am Expert
Advisors can also eliminate the emotional trading decisions that usually cripple
novice Forex trading accounts. Forex Expert Advisors exercise unmatched
discipline when trading and can be designed to evaluate more parameters at the
same time than any human could keep an eye on at once.
All of the technical indicators that are available in the MT-4 platform can
be brought to bear in the logic used by an Expert Advisor in almost any way that
one can think of thanks to the MQL-4 programming language. All types of moving
averages (simple, exponential, etc.), RSI, CCI, etc. You can also create your
own custom indicator and call upon it from an Expert Advisor.
There are
many different types of MT-4 Expert Advisors depending on their intended
application. Some are designed specifically to trade news events and remain out
of the market all other times while other MT-4 Expert Advisors are meant to
remain active 24x7. Experienced traders who have their own fine tuned manual
trading systems sometimes hire MQL-4 programmers to automate their systems
thereby creating custom MT-4 Expert Advisors. All expert advisors have the same
goal and that is to automate trading operations and generate a profit while
doing so.
How does a Forex Expert Advisor work ?
The program works by calculating the different indicators that it was
designed to use and take actions when the market conditions meet the correct
criteria as described in the source code of the Expert Advisor.
Fore Example. A simple expert advisor may say something like this:
"If the 9 and 20 day moving averages cross with the 9 day MA above the 20 MA
and the RSI is higher than 50 then open a long position (buy)"
That is just an example. You can assign countless conditions for entering and
exiting the market as well as managing trades for trailing stops and multiple
take profit levels.
An MT-4 Expert Advisor is usually divided into three parts: A startup or
‘init’ function, a main function and a ‘deinit’ or cleanup function. The Expert
Advisor will run through its startup function once upon startup and will run
through its ‘deinit’ or clean-up function once at the end. In the mean time, the
MT-4 Expert Advisor program runs through a cycle of its main function over and
over with every incoming tick while it is attached to a chart and active. Once
running, the Expert Advisor will not start another cycle for a new tick if it is
still in the middle of processing the previous one.
Here is a simple outline of what a simple expert advisor could be programmed
to do.
(This would be the 'main' part of the EA and takes place every time a tick
comes in.)
- 1- Check my account. Is there enough equity to open a trade? if so, continue.
If not, end.
- 2- Are there any open trades right now?
- 2a- If there are, do they need to be closed or do they need their trailing
stop adjusted? (do so if needed and exit.)
- 2b- If there are no open trades, are the market conditions right to open one?
(do so if needed and exit. )
- 3- End.
How to use an Expert Advisor
In order to make use of an Expert Advisor you have to install it on
MetaTrader and then attach it to the appropriate chart on MetaTrader 4. This is
fairly simple as will be described below. If there are any instructions included
with your Expert Advisor you should read them in their entirety.
#1- First, you have to put the Expert Advisor in a place where MetaTrader 4
will be able to use it. In most installations of MetaTrader 4 that place is
C:\Program Files\MetaTrader 4\experts The actual Expert Advisor
is a file without an icon that ends with .EX4
#2- Now that the Expert Advisor is in the correct location within your
computer, re-start MetaTrader 4.
#3- When MetaTrader 4 starts up again you will now see the new Expert Advisor
on the left navigation menu.
Can I run more than one Expert Advisor
on the same account/client terminal ?
Yes. You can run multiple instances of an Expert Advisor on the same
MetaTrader 4 client terminal. As long as all of the Expert Advisors that you
are running in the same client terminal have been designed to get along with
each other on the same terminal. (not all Expert Advisors can get along on
the same terminal) Mainly because they will try to manage each other’s open
trades. Programmers get around this by using magic numbers in the market
entrance part of the source code of the Expert Advisor.
There are also
platform limitations. Only one Expert Advisor can communicate with the trading
server at any one time. If multiple Expert Advisors are active on the same
terminal and more than one try to communicate with the trading server you will
get "Trade context busy" errors in the logs when this happens if you have too
many Expert Advisors on one client terminal.
